do any rallypack guns primarily use raycasting ngl
Closest thing to it would be the snipers which use a bunch of short recursive raycasts over distance to bypass the 200tu/s limitation, accompanied by an animated staticshape to 'fake' the projectile. While it does use containerRaycast it's not quite the same thing as hitscan
